The New Zealand Road Transport and Logistics Industry Training Organisation has completed the review of the unit standards listed above.

 

Date new versions published                        October 2006

 

Planned review date                        December 2011

 

Summary of review and consultation process

 

The review of these seven unit standards, in the Cargo Operations and Port Machinery Operations domains, was initiated by their anticipated expiry dates of December 2005 and December 2006.

 

An Industry Advisory Group (IAG) was established, comprising technical representatives from within the ports and stevedoring sector, and a range of assessors and training providers.  The members were asked to specifically focus on whether the unit standards were still meeting industry needs, and to recommend changes to the content and legislation of the unit standards to bring them up-to-date with current industry practice and to future proof them against potential industry changes.

 

Main changes resulting from the review

 

Main amendments made to the unit standards include updates to the legislation and the range statements of the performance criteria and incorporating into unit standard 18954 the Land Transport New Zealand requirements about driving a vehicle within a Port Area.

 

The opportunity was also taken during the review to make minor wording amendments to elements and performance criteria to ensure the unit standards can be understood easily and assessment can be carried out fairly.
